    Two Late Victorian Travelling Communion Sets
    the first hallmarked, London, 1883, John Brashier, the cup and paten of plain form, the cruet in the form of a wine ewer with pull off lid surmounted by cross weight, inscription on underside of paten, "Presented to the Revd George Peacock Metcalf by the officers and friends of the St Silas Sunday School as a tribute of respect on his leaving Hull Jany 8th 1886 F G Linsley Superintendent", weight 50gm, h 9cm; the second communion set hallmarked London, 1891, Mappin & Webb, hemispherical bowl, cruet bottle silver and glass with screw cap, weight 80gm (silver), h 7.5cm (6)
